Business Overview

Renova is a company that develops, owns, and operates renewable energy power plants. Specifically, the company operates power generation businesses using renewable energy sources including solar, biomass, wind, geothermal, and hydroelectric power. Additionally, Renova is advancing green transformation initiatives that include battery storage and new fuels.

Renova's business is divided into two main segments. The first is "Renewable Energy Power Generation and Related Operations," which involves long-term ownership of power plants and electricity sales. The second is "Development and Operations," which handles the development and operational management of new power plants. These operations are conducted through consolidated subsidiaries and affiliated companies.

The adoption of renewable energy is a global trend, and Renova is expanding its business in line with this movement. Within Japan, government policy is driving efforts to increase the share of renewable energy, and Renova is targeting growth in this market.

Renova sells renewable energy electricity through the Feed-in Tariff (FIT) scheme and the Feed-in Premium (FIP) scheme. The company also meets renewable energy demand through long-term corporate power purchase agreements (Corporate PPAs).

Renova has established a system to handle all aspects of power plant operations from construction through management, and raises capital through project finance. This approach supports long-term business operations and contributions to local communities.

Management Policy

Renova is a growing company in the renewable energy sector, aiming to be a leading company in energy transformation, particularly in Japan and Asia. The company promotes the development of sustainable energy systems by utilizing diverse renewable energy sources including solar, biomass, wind, geothermal, and hydroelectric power.

The company's growth strategy focuses on a medium to long-term commitment to the renewable energy market. Driven by Japanese government policy to increase the share of renewable energy, Renova aims for growth in this market. Additionally, the company is focusing on the battery storage market and advancing technology development to support stable power supply.

As an independent company, Renova promotes power generation development and Green Transformation (GX) business both domestically and internationally. In particular, the company focuses on developing solar and onshore wind power projects, and operates a business model that supplies electricity directly to corporations through Corporate Power Purchase Agreements (PPAs).

The company pursues high profitability by internalizing engineering and key development operations. This increases the success rate of business development and enables rapid business expansion. Additionally, stable cash flows are reinvested in new business development and growth of existing operations to achieve sustained growth.

Renova prioritizes coexistence and co-creation with local communities, aiming for long-term development. The company utilizes renewable energy power plants in various regions as local resources and builds cooperative relationships with local communities. This enables regionally-rooted business operations.
